Get the Felsteel set (Blacksmith) and Cloak of Eternity (Tailoring). Those are items you can get immediately. Then, work the drop, quest, rep list in sticky.

I'm at work and can't check your armory, so i apologize if I'm telling you an item you already have.

Do whatever it takes to get 15 badges for your Libram of Repentance. It goes a long way towards your uncrushability.

Not only that, but the SSO dailies will get you two AWESOME shields...

The Dawnforge is a slight upgrade from Nightbane's shield in Kara, and the Crest is a better itemized cross-grade from it that will go a long way for threat :D
